AgriCommunication Program: Step 4. After you apply

Step 4. After you apply

1. Your application is verified

After your application is received, a program officer verifies that all required forms and declarations have been completed and there is sufficient detail in the application for a full assessment.

2. Your application is reviewed

A full review and assessment of your application against the principles and criteria of the program will be carried out by assessors including program administrators and other technical reviewers within Agriculture and Agri-Food Canada (AAFC).

At any point after you apply, AAFC may contact you for more information.

Should your application be approved, a program officer will communicate with you to go over the details of the approval including activities, funding levels as well as start and end dates. The program officer will then follow up with you to negotiate the details and enter into a Contribution Agreement. It should be noted that even if an approval is granted, AAFC does not have the authority to reimburse recipients for costs incurred until a Contribution Agreement is signed.

Service standards

Once you submit an application, AAFC's goal is to achieve its service standards at a minimum of 80% of the time under normal circumstances:

  1. acknowledge receipt of your application within 1 business day
  2. respond to general inquiries made by phone or email before the end of the next business day
  3. assess your application and send you an approval or a rejection notification letter typically within 100 business days of the close of the application intake window, or within 100 business days of the application being deemed complete, if received after the intake period.
